Olduvai Gorge and Laetoli contain the oldest evidence of human ancestors, including footprints preserved in volcanic ash. This makes Tanzania fundamentally important to understanding human evolution. The discoveries by the Leakey family transformed our understanding of human origins.
For centuries, the Swahili Coast was the center of Indian Ocean trade. Stone towns like Kilwa and Zanzibar's Stone Town show architectural fusion of African, Arab, and Persian influences. Swahili language and culture became the coastal identity that now unites much of East Africa.
The Maji Maji Rebellion (1905-1907) was one of Africa's most significant anti-colonial wars. Though brutally suppressed by German forces, it demonstrated early Pan-African unity as over 20 different ethnic groups fought together. The rebellion became a symbol of resistance and national identity.
Julius Nyerere, 'Mwalimu' (teacher), created one of Africa's most stable nations through his vision of Ujamaa and education. His emphasis on Swahili as a national language and investment in primary education gave Tanzania high literacy rates and strong national identity rare in post-colonial Africa.

For most Indian travellers, the best time to visit Tanzania is June–October (dry season).
June–October – dry season, best for safari and Great Migration, animals gather around waterholes.
December–February – warm, good for safari and Zanzibar, shorter rains.
March–May – long rains, lush landscapes, but some roads may be difficult.
If you want the best chance to see the Great Migration and the Big Five, June–October are the most iconic months.

Tanzania is usually accessed by flight via major hubs:
By air: Connect from Delhi, Mumbai, Bengaluru, Chennai, Kolkata to Kilimanjaro (JRO) or Dar es Salaam (DAR) via Dubai, Doha, Abu Dhabi, Istanbul, Nairobi, or Addis Ababa. Flight time is typically 6–10 hours including layover.
Local transport: Road safaris in 4×4 safari vehicles or fly‑in safaris from Arusha/Kilimanjaro to Serengeti, Ngorongoro, Tarangire, and Zanzibar.

Olduvai Gorge in northern Tanzania contains some of the oldest hominid fossils ever discovered, earning Tanzania the title 'Cradle of Humanity.' Early hunter-gatherer societies like the Hadzabe and Sandawe still inhabit parts of the country today.
Bantu-speaking peoples migrated into the region, bringing iron-working technology and agricultural practices. These migrations formed the foundation for many of Tanzania's modern ethnic groups and laid the groundwork for settled communities and trade networks.
The Swahili Coast flourished as a hub of Indian Ocean trade, connecting Africa with Arabia, Persia, India, and China. Powerful city-states like Kilwa Kisiwani grew rich from gold, ivory, and slave trade. Swahili culture and language emerged from this cultural fusion.
European explorers like Livingstone and Burton arrived. Germany established German East Africa (1885-1919), building infrastructure but imposing harsh rule. The Maji Maji Rebellion (1905-1907) was a significant anti-colonial uprising that unified diverse ethnic groups against German rule.
After WWI, Britain took control under a League of Nations mandate. Tanganyika developed economically but independence movements grew. Julius Nyerere's Tanganyika African National Union (TANU) led the peaceful struggle for independence, achieved in 1961.
Tanganyika gained independence in 1961 under Prime Minister Julius Nyerere. Zanzibar followed in 1963. In 1964, the two nations united to form the United Republic of Tanzania, creating one of Africa's most successful political unions.
Nyerere implemented Ujamaa (African socialism), focusing on rural development and self-reliance. While economically challenging, it promoted national unity and education. Since the 1980s, Tanzania has transitioned to a market economy while maintaining political stability, becoming a leader in wildlife conservation and African diplomacy.
